  • Aging Challenges

    Aging athletes face unique challenges as they strive to maintain their competitive edge while dealing with the inevitable physical decline. and share their experiences of balancing their mental acuity with their body's limitations. Sue describes this as a "dance," where some days she feels invincible, and others, her body reminds her of its limits 1. Megan echoes this sentiment, acknowledging that if physical abilities were equal, they would outperform younger athletes due to their experience and knowledge 1.

    Retirement Transition

    As they approach retirement, athletes like Sue and Megan grapple with the transition from sports to life beyond the field. Sue reflects on the identity crisis that accompanies retirement, questioning who she is without basketball 3. Megan, on the other hand, discusses the challenge of balancing her soccer career with securing her financial future, especially given the disparities in treatment and pay in women's sports 4.

    Managing Doubt

    Self-doubt is a common experience for athletes, even those at the top of their game. and Megan discuss the "Sunday scaries," a feeling of anxiety and doubt about their abilities, especially after taking breaks from training 5. Megan shares how she manages these feelings by gradually easing back into training, which helps her regain confidence in her physical capabilities 5.
